Output a50eb6f59daedda31829711ccdadb3ab37e70f45217c1e6f3a8033f07fda3c0d:150

value
352207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85be9b25744e2b6000df8572fe6260721c9978d0 OP_EQUAL
address
3DtC8bajajM5CxVgSHGeniBVFV3pYBNNyu
transaction
a50eb6f59daedda31829711ccdadb3ab37e70f45217c1e6f3a8033f07fda3c0d
spent
true